(1 point) In this problem we consider an equation in differential form M dx + N dy = 0. (8x + 8y)dx + (8x + 4y)dy = 0 Find My =
OLga [1]

The ODE is exact because M_y=N_x. Then

F_x=8x+8y\implies F(x,y)=4x^2+8xy+g(y)

F_y=8x+g'(y)=8x+4y\implies g'(y)=4y\implies g(y)=2y^2+C

So we have

F(x,y)=4x^2+8xy+2y^2=C

What percent of 150 is 162
Novay_Z [31]
To find a percentage of a number, you divide by that number.
So to find what percent of 150 162 is, you divide 162 by 150
162 ÷ 150 = 1.08
Now, to find the percentage, we take the decimal and move the point two places to the right.
1.08 = 108%
162 is 108% of 150.
